Storage capacity
When choosing a fridge, the capacity of storage is a key factor to take into consideration. The refrigerator is supposed to be able of holding the food items you normally store, while leaving enough space for leftovers. Depending on how much food you consume, you might require a bigger refrigerator than the one you have. A larger refrigerator will use more energy and can be expensive to operate.
The top tall fridges have shelves that are adjustable and can hold a variety of items. Some fridges feature an adjustable bin or additional shelf for larger containers like 2-liter bottles, whereas others have shelves on the door that can be adjusted to fit smaller items. This flexibility allows you to personalize your fridge to your requirements.
If you're looking for a small fridge, you should consider a smaller cube model that has an internal freezer compartment that is smaller. These fridges are available in a variety of colors and are ideal for offices and dorms. Another alternative is a 3.2 cubic foot double-door fridge from RCA. It's higher than other models which makes it perfect for a dorm space or an accessory unit for your home.
Larger models are more popular in homes and feature French-door refrigerators that have bottom freezers. These refrigerators are larger than top freezer models and are used more to store food instead of ice cream. The typical french-door refrigerator is 42 inches wide and 70 inches tall However, you can find smaller models that are designed to fit in an encapsulated kitchen.
Measure the height and width of your space before buying an extra tall refrigerator to determine the appropriate size. Keep in mind that you'll have to leave at least 1/2 inch clearance on all sides of your refrigerator to allow air circulation and to avoid overheating. Also, keep in mind that hinges will add to the overall height of the appliance.
When determining what size refrigerator to purchase consider the size of your family and food storage needs. On average you should have approximately five cubic feet of space for each person in your home. This will ensure that you have enough space for all your favorite foods and drinks, while keeping your counters clear to eat and cook.
